Dark Sky Gazing to Commence Tonight
Loading
   
Friday, September 3, 2021
 

BY KAREN BOSSICK

Dark Sky lovers will hold a Dark Sky Event to kick off the long Labor Day weekend tonight—Friday, Sept. 3--from 8:30 to 9:30 p.m. at the SNRA headquarters seven miles north of Ketchum on Highway 75.

Starlight providing, of course!

The event will start inside with some explanatory discussions. Then it will move outside the parking lot as it gets dark.

Attendees are encouraged to bring binoculars, flashlights covered with red cellophane or some other covering so the light doesn’t interfere with the dark, headlamps with red lights and warm jackets.
